Why am I not getting water to my heater core?
(1990 Oldsmobile Cutlass Ciera)

Hot water doesn't travel from pump through tube to core. vacuum issue? Faulty pump? Obviously water is cycling through the motor but not to the heater core. Its been replaced with new core and still doesn't receive water from pump.

After engine has reached *normal operating temperature* - grasp BOTH heater hoses - you shouldn’t be able to hold on to them for more than a few seconds .. This will determine IF coolant is flowing through the core - IF both hoses are HOT - problem is elsewhere - HVAC temperature control baffling or the control itself.
